Industrial Technical Buyer
Job description
An important industrial company with international presence is looking to incorporate an Industrial Technical Buyer to join its Corporate Purchasing team.
The selected person will be responsible for the planning and management of purchases of technical components and materials necessary for the development and industrialization of industrial equipment and solutions. They will participate in all phases of the project, from identifying needs to supplier qualification and launch into production, actively contributing to cost optimization, continuous improvement, and supply assurance.
Responsibilities
- Identify, analyze, and select products and suppliers that adapt to the defined technical, quality, and cost needs.
- Manage the search, evaluation, and development of national and international suppliers.
- Conduct supplier visits and audits to evaluate production capabilities, service levels, and quality standards.
- Lead purchasing projects from the initial phases through to the qualification of suppliers and components.
- Request, analyze, and compare offers for new projects, carrying out negotiations and award processes.
- Participate in the definition, monitoring, and control of project cost objectives.
- Detect and drive opportunities for economic optimization and process improvement within the supply chain.
- Ensure supply continuity through adequate risk management and contingency plans.
- Negotiate contracts, framework agreements, pricing, and commercial conditions with strategic suppliers.
- Define and implement category purchasing strategies.
- Manage and develop the supplier panel to ensure competitiveness, quality, and innovation.
- Collaborate closely with Engineering, Operations, Quality, and Supply Chain teams to ensure project success.
